Copper Faces Historic Tightness as Global Stockpiles Plummet

Data from global commodity exchanges reveals copper prices moved higher to $4.70 per pound today. This represents a 1.01% daily gain and continues the metal’s recovery from April’s market turbulence.

The price surge comes amid unprecedented inventory drawdowns across major warehouses and growing signs of a structural supply deficit. Physical copper markets display alarming tightness as warehouse stocks reach critical levels.

London Metal Exchange inventories have fallen sharply with on-warrant stocks at just 108,725 tons. Shanghai’s market shows steeper backwardation with prompt-month contracts commanding substantial premiums over three-month futures.

Commodity trading house Mercuria recently warned that China’s copper stockpiles could completely vanish within months. This dramatic reduction stems partly from traders redirecting shipments to American ports.

Traders anticipate potential US tariffs following President Trump’s implementation of 145% duties on Chinese goods. The US-China trade relationship shows tentative signs of improvement.

China’s Commerce Ministry confirmed Beijing is “evaluating” Washington’s offer to hold talks about tariffs. This development sparked cautious optimism among traders who had feared escalating protectionism.

Copper Market Faces Structural Supply Crunch

Copper currently trades at a significant premium in New York versus London markets. The difference amounts to approximately 13-15% as traders position themselves ahead of potential tariff announcements.

Goldman Sachs estimates 45-60% of global reported copper inventories could reach US shores by Q3 2025. Long-term demand fundamentals remain exceptionally strong.

The International Energy Forum projects the world needs 115% more copper in the next 30 years than humans have mined throughout history. This demand surge stems from global electrification efforts and renewable energy transitions.

New consumption sources amplify traditional industrial needs. Data centers require between 10,000-15,000 tons each for power infrastructure. Electric vehicles consume 83kg of copper versus 22kg for conventional automobiles.

Building electrification drives substantial demand for wiring, transformers, and cooling systems. Supply constraints appear increasingly structural rather than cyclical.

Mining companies face declining ore grades, extended development timelines, and permitting challenges lasting over 12 years in developed nations. Even with record exploration spending, discovery costs have quadrupled compared to twenty years ago.

Market analysis suggests a significant supply deficit approaching. Current projections indicate a shortfall of approximately 780,000 tonnes emerging by 2026.

This deficit expands further without substantial new project development. The market has already gained 17.96% year-to-date despite recent volatility.

Copper trades at 0.0015 times gold’s price, sitting 42% below its 20-year average. This historical relationship suggests potential upside as structural deficits materialize in coming years.
